    Quote Originally Posted by kmb View Post
    This car looks absolutely fantastic.

    Living half in Lyon and half in UK, I often pass through Reims on the auto-route, what is there to see (wasn't sure which photos were from there)?
    Thanks, It has got the old grandstand, pit lane and tower on the start finish straight. Although you can still drive most of the old circuit, which is all public road now.
